Always pass an allocator to YAMLTraits.
The YAML traits new's when not passed an allocator to parse data. For atom types, this is a leak as we don't destruct atoms. For the File here, we do actually destruct File's so that single case of not using an allocator will be fine. Should fix a bunch more leaks. llvm-svn: 263680
